波浪号一般在排版中使用,以表示一个缩略的等效形式。在MATLAB中,我们可以使用一些方法将波浪号打到中间位置。下面我将分享一些实用的技巧和经验。
& H0 D3 [; g: ~" u' ~7 N8 U
6 s; W# ]# e! |' n首先,我们需要了解MATLAB中的文本排版。通常情况下,波浪号是通过输入"~"来实现的。然而,这种方式无法将波浪号置于中间位置。为了解决这个问题,我们可以使用Latex语法来实现波浪号的居中。
+ F7 v5 J2 y2 o ?- O5 b
+ k. a6 G$ z; S在MATLAB的文本处理中,我们可以使用Latex语法来设置排版格式。具体来说,我们可以使用`\tilde{}`命令来生成居中的波浪号。例如,我们可以使用以下代码将波浪号打到中间位置:; O7 @: J' t5 W2 w* N# i
' k2 a' q0 }* B! C```matlab& `2 x# v/ O4 V8 P
text(0.5, 0.5, '$\tilde{}$', 'HorizontalAlignment', 'center', 'FontSize', 20);
# _# ~( E5 N# f F) N```1 X1 B9 h9 e3 A7 ?" V8 A
5 W! R4 {% \8 q! Y在这段代码中,我们使用`text()`函数来添加文本,参数`(0.5, 0.5)`表示将文本放置在画布的中心位置。`'$\tilde{}$'`是一个带有Latex语法的字符串,用来生成波浪号。`'HorizontalAlignment', 'center'`用于将波浪号居中对齐。最后,`'FontSize', 20`设置了文本的字体大小。0 D% h, Z. A" b5 {
3 D& x1 u& \- n1 _, q6 }除了使用Latex语法,我们还可以通过调整Unicode字符的位置来实现波浪号的居中。例如,我们可以使用以下代码将波浪号打到中间位置:
) {1 R0 O5 Q i9 U4 B8 I7 M4 f" z# {: g- U! D" X! T/ x
```matlab: R# h+ U/ Z, ^3 c5 u( q
c = ['\u223C'];- [) U/ e0 ?3 S2 ?, V- {
text(0.5, 0.5, c, 'HorizontalAlignment', 'center', 'FontSize', 20);
+ {: j# Z$ J8 G" z``` e2 s3 F6 m& m6 a, z4 j
- \8 T3 I9 F" U' [' V/ b
在这段代码中,`'\u223C'`是波浪号的Unicode编码。我们可以直接将其作为文本添加到画布上。
2 m. y* t9 A4 {' Z7 h' v: \3 Z, p+ g+ A
另外,如果您需要在MATLAB中使用波浪号作为变量名或标识符,可以使用字符数组来表示。例如,我们可以使用以下代码创建一个包含波浪号的变量名:! q( |; t T8 g3 V
6 b1 H$ F# L) X. ?! }4 k2 r
```matlab
2 G; c; P4 _6 |5 G O2 [varName = ['~'];
$ L4 S/ d" e* u# ?5 E/ S! I```
/ Q4 C4 o/ H0 k- n2 M! v
3 B5 k2 Z, h- e) Q& c通过这种方式,我们可以在MATLAB的计算过程中自由使用波浪号。
8 J' C+ x9 y& r8 m% ]( u& I" ?: x: n7 e6 C. k, b/ s) o- D
总而言之,对于将波浪号打到中间位置的需求,MATLAB提供了多种方法。我们可以使用Latex语法或Unicode字符来实现波浪号的居中,同时也可以将其作为字符数组在计算中使用。这些技巧和经验将帮助您更好地使用MATLAB进行文本排版和计算。希望这些内容对您有所帮助,并能提升您的工作效率和体验。 |